Rue B Restaurant Review:
The owners of Rue B seem to know exactly what the burgeoning Avenue B neighborhood wants. A casual place for inexpensive eats that looks like it's been there for decades. Rue B fits the bill on all counts. There's the menu of good panini and sharable appetizers like charcuterie and creative salads paired with Latin-inspired batidos. And then there's the décor: exposed brick wall and bar stools and banquettes that look like they were rescued from a 1930s diner---because they were.
